Argent Commander is a rare neutral minion card, from the Classic set.

How to get

Argent Commander can be obtained through Classic card packs, through crafting, or as an Arena reward. Regular Argent Commander can also be obtained through the Highest Rank Bonus chest at the end of a Ranked season, or as a first-time reward for first time reaching Silver 10 or Gold 10 in Ranked mode.

Strategy

This is one of two 6 mana minions with Charge available, the other being LegacyReckless Rocketeer. This leaves you with the choice between 1 more Attack or Divine Shield. In most cases, Argent Commander is a better choice since Divine Shield makes it much more versatile and tempo-efficient. When played offensively, the opponent needs two sources of damage to destroy it without access to hard removal. It can also be played defensively to trade into another minion and leave a 4/2 on board.

The Grand TournamentArgent Horserider is a cheaper version of this card, boasting many of the same tactical qualities Argent Commander has, but can be played much earlier, making it a better pick for aggro decks. Descent of DragonsEvasive Wyrm is a better defensive version of the card, gaining an extra Attack, Evasive, and Dragon synergy in exchange for Charge. As a generic finisher, LegacyLeeroy Jenkins is better.

Lore

Wowpedia iconThis section uses content from Wowpedia.
The Argent Crusade is an order of holy warriors formed from the union of the Reformed Order of the Silver Hand and the Argent Dawn. Led by the paladin LegacyTirion Fordring, the Argent Crusade was a major contributor to the successful campaign in Northrend that toppled the Lich King.
According to the quest Tirion's Help, Tirion Fordring handpicked every member in the Argent Crusade in order to avoid infiltration by the Cult of the Damned. This was presumably to prevent a repeat of the Inigo Montoy incident, which resulted in Naxxramas returning to Northrend and NaxxramasKel'Thuzad regaining corporeal form.
Argent Commanders can be found guarding the Frozen Halls of Icecrown Citadel alongside Ebon Blade Commanders.
